North Easton, Mass. — The LIU men's basketball team fell short against Stonehill on Thursday night — but the Sharks did not go down without a fight.
Tre' Wood scored a team-high 20 points for the Sharks and dished out five assists inside the Merkert Gymnasium.
LIU, which lost to the Skyhawks 75-60, had three double-digit scorers in its final regular season matchup against Stonehill.
Frehsman guard R.J. Greene scored 12 points and Cheikh Ndiaye dropped 10 points in the Sharks' final road game of the regular season.
LIU next plays Saturday at 1 p.m. inside the Steinberg Wellness Center.
